Telegram: The Go-To App for Extremists and Troublemakers

- Telegram, launched in 2013, has become a hub for extremist activity due to its light-touch content moderation and private chat settings. - The app was used to coordinate anti-immigrant riots in the UK, prompting Prime Minister Keir Starmer to vow a crackdown on social media platforms. - Unlike WhatsApp and Signal, Telegram's encryption is not end-to-end by default, raising concerns about user privacy and security. - Extremists exploit Telegram's channel feature to spread hate speech and disinformation, making it a potent tool for radicalization. - Governments struggle to track and control extremist activities on Telegram, especially since the platform is based in Dubai and not easily influenced by Western law enforcement.
